Tecnologico de Monterrey (TdM), founded in 1943, is a multicampus private higher education institution in Mexico with a presence in 32 cities and 20 of the 32 states of the country. The student community at the bachelor level comprises a population of 54,762 individuals served by a faculty of 2084 full-time professors. Faculty and academic programmes are organised into six schools aligned with the following academic divisions: School of Engineering and Sciences, School of Business, School of Architecture, Art and Design, School of Social Sciences and Government, School of Medicine and Health Sciences, and School of Humanities and Education. TdM’s commitment to sustainability has evolved over 30 years, leading to the current goals set out in its Climate Change and Sustainability Plan 2025. In this chapter, we present the results of our analyses of the responses of 590 student respondents to a survey, from which it is apparent that TdM students perceive the primary focus regarding sustainability issues in their academic programmes to be along the environmental dimension, followed closely by the social and economic dimensions. The respondents ranked the sustainability competences their programmes instilled, and the results show that Interpersonal relations and collaboration, Systems thinking, Anticipatory thinking, Critical thinking and analysis, and Communication and use of media were ranked the highest. The pedagogical approaches employed by faculty were also ranked, with Project- or problem-based learning and Case studies ranked the highest. In addition to the separate rankings of sustainability competences and pedagogical approaches, the survey responses were analysed for a correlation between the competences and pedagogical approaches in order to determine the main competences developed by the undergraduate programmes and the pedagogical approaches that develop the most competences. The top three competences developed by TdM undergraduate programmes were: Tolerance for ambiguity and uncertainty; Interdisciplinary research; and Justice, responsibility, and ethics. The pedagogical approach with the strongest correlation with developing sustainability competences was Traditional ecological knowledge, followed by four pedagogical approaches with equal correlation strengths: Lecturing, Eco-justice and community, Place-based environmental education, and Supply chain/life cycle analysis. The survey results show that, from the students’ perspective, their academic programmes develop sustainability competences through identifiable pedagogical approaches.
